Mortar Fire Simulator
Item Name Code (INC) 49735
![]() |
A pyrotechnic item designed to simulate the sound of mortar fire.
Additional Information for Mortar Fire Simulator
Mortar Fire Simulators are pyrotechnic devices that are used to simulate the firing of mortar rounds during training exercises. They are designed to replicate the visual and auditory effects of actual mortar fire, without the use of live ammunition.
These simulators are typically used by military and law enforcement personnel to train and familiarize themselves with the operation and effects of mortar fire. They can be used in various training scenarios, such as tactical exercises, live-fire drills, and simulation-based training.
Mortar Fire Simulators are classified under the supply class Pyrotechnics, which refers to devices that produce visible or audible effects through the combustion of pyrotechnic compositions. Pyrotechnics are commonly used in military and civilian applications for signaling, illumination, and training purposes.
In terms of supply group, Mortar Fire Simulators fall under Ammunition And Explosives. This supply group encompasses various types of ammunition, explosives, and related items used in military operations and training. It includes items such as firearms ammunition, grenades, rockets, and other explosive devices.
It is important to note that Mortar Fire Simulators are non-lethal devices and are strictly used for training purposes. They are designed to provide a safe and controlled environment for personnel to practice mortar fire techniques and procedures.
